matlab怎么将序列保存为excel
在科学计算和数据分析中,MATLAB是一种常用的编程语言和环境。如果你需要将序列数据保存为Excel文件,MATLAB提供了一些简单而强大的函数和工具来实现这个目标。
下面是一种常用的方法来将序列保存为Excel文件:
1. 创建一个序列数据
在MATLAB中,首先需要创建一个序列数据。可以使用linspace函数来生成一个等差序列,也可以手动创建一个数组。
示例代码:
```
x linspace(0, 10, 100); % 创建一个从0到10的等差序列,共100个元素
```
2. 导入Excel相关的MATLAB工具箱
使用MATLAB操作Excel文件之前,需要导入MATLAB相关的工具箱。可以使用命令"addpath"来添加工具箱的路径。
示例代码:
```
addpath('C:Program FilesMATLABR2020a oolboxmatlabiofun'); % 添加MATLAB I/O工具箱的路径
```
3. 创建Excel文件并写入序列数据
使用MATLAB提供的xlswrite函数,可以创建一个新的Excel文件并将序列数据写入其中。该函数需要两个参数:文件名和数据矩阵。
示例代码:
```
filename 'sequence_data.xlsx'; % 定义保存的Excel文件名
xlswrite(filename, x'); % 写入序列数据到Excel文件中(转置x以匹配Excel的行列顺序)
```
4. 保存Excel文件
在将数据写入Excel文件后,使用MATLAB的save命令将文件保存起来。这样可以确保数据被正确地写入Excel文件中。
示例代码:
```
save(filename); % 保存Excel文件
```
通过以上步骤,你就可以使用MATLAB将序列数据保存为Excel文件了。
总结:
本文介绍了如何使用MATLAB将序列数据保存为Excel文件的方法。首先需要创建序列数据,然后导入Excel相关的MATLAB工具箱,接着创建Excel文件并将数据写入其中,最后保存Excel文件。通过这些简单的步骤和示例代码,你可以轻松地将序列数据保存为Excel文件,方便后续的数据分析和处理工作。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。